Hate to rain on your parade, but MGSV will more than likely have co-op.

Peace Walker served as a testing grounds for features in MGSV. Kojima has said repeatedly that he considers the co-op feature a big success. Then there is the fact that he's confirmed that we'll be able to visit our friends bases.

Co-op is all but confirmed at this point. Though luckily it won't be forced on the player.

Well yeah if it's not your thing then it's not your thing.

Unfortunately though, you played the worst two in the series when it comes to cutscene/gameplay ratio lol. MGS2 was the first one on PS2 and MGS4 was the one on PS3. MGS2 had some great replay value, but the lack of unique gameplay was largely made up for in the Substance versions extra content.

MGS3 had plenty of content though, more than most single player action adventure games. Peace Walker has almost too much content and MGSV is a direct follow up to that.
